On Aug 6, 2009, at 2:42 PM, Andreas Zeidler wrote:
On Aug 6, 2009, at 6:30 AM, David Glick wrote:On Aug 5, 2009, at 1:45 PM, Alec Mitchell wrote:On Wed, Aug 5, 2009 at 1:18 PM, David Glick<davidgl...@onenw.org> wrote:* IPublishTraverse is used where ITraverse should be; that's why somelinkintegrity tests are failing.Actually they both need to be used. And that's just a guess -- I haven'tactually looked at this yet.It doesn't look like there's any way to override OFS traversal using acomponent (other than a view of course). Perhaps we should just be using the existing custom __getitem__ that's already in BaseObject/BaseFolder instead of traversal magic.That seems like a decent idea to me, given that we need this to work for publish traversal, OFS traversal, and path expressions in order to avoid regressions.i've just tested linkintegrity in a blob-enabled setup (in order to use the traversal adapter from `plone.app.imaging` in a known to work environment, i.e. plone 3.x) and it turns out that it still has 13 failures [...]
btw, are there any other reasons/breakages besides the linkintegrity failures? i suppose i could make the latter aware of the traversal adapter, too. do we know of any (important) 3rd-party products that rely on being able to traverse to image scales the old way?
cheers, andi
-- zeidler it consulting - http://zitc.de/ - i...@zitc.de friedelstraße 31 - 12047 berlin - telefon +49 30 25563779 pgp key at http://zitc.de/pgp - http://wwwkeys.de.pgp.net/ plone 3.3rc4 released! -- http://plone.org/products/plone/
PGP.sig
Description: This is a digitally signed message part
_______________________________________________ Framework-Team mailing list Framework-Team@lists.plone.org http://lists.plone.org/mailman/listinfo/framework-team